Fiber: Which kind of carbohydrate is very important for digestive health?

5 min read

According to the Mayo Clinic, most Americans consume only about 15 grams of fiber per day, roughly half of the recommended 25 to 35 grams. This shortfall highlights a critical gap in many modern diets, as dietary fiber is the type of carbohydrate that is very important for digestive health. A diverse intake of this non-digestible carbohydrate is essential for maintaining a healthy gut microbiome, ensuring regular bowel movements, and reducing the risk of chronic diseases.

Understanding the Most Important Carbohydrate for Gut Health

Unlike sugars and starches that are broken down and absorbed in the small intestine, dietary fiber passes through largely undigested until it reaches the large intestine. This characteristic makes it fundamentally different and vital for a healthy digestive system. Instead of providing immediate energy, fiber's primary role is to feed beneficial gut bacteria and facilitate the efficient movement of waste through the body.

The Two Main Types of Dietary Fiber

Dietary fiber is not a single entity but a diverse group of carbohydrates found in plant foods. It is generally categorized into two main types, both essential for a comprehensive approach to digestive wellness. Many high-fiber foods naturally contain a mix of both.

Soluble Fiber

Soluble fiber dissolves in water, forming a gel-like substance in the digestive tract. This gel has several important functions:

  • It slows down digestion and the emptying of the stomach, which can help regulate blood sugar levels and extend the feeling of fullness after a meal.
  • It helps bind cholesterol in the digestive system, preventing some of it from being absorbed and thereby lowering blood cholesterol levels.
  • It acts as a prebiotic, serving as food for the beneficial bacteria in your gut. This fermentation process produces important compounds called short-chain fatty acids (SCFAs), which nourish the cells lining the colon.

Foods rich in soluble fiber include oats, barley, nuts, seeds, legumes (beans, peas, and lentils), and many fruits and vegetables, such as apples, carrots, and citrus fruits. Psyllium husk is a well-known soluble fiber supplement often used to improve regularity.

Insoluble Fiber

Insoluble fiber does not dissolve in water. Instead, it remains largely intact as it moves through the digestive tract. Its benefits include:

  • Adding Bulk to Stool: It increases the weight and size of your stool, which helps it pass more easily through the intestines. This is crucial for preventing constipation and ensuring regular bowel movements.
  • Promoting Bowel Regularity: By stimulating the muscles of the intestine, insoluble fiber speeds up the transit time of food waste through the digestive system.
  • Supporting Bowel Health: A diet rich in insoluble fiber can reduce the risk of digestive issues like hemorrhoids and diverticular disease.

Excellent sources of insoluble fiber include whole grains (whole-wheat flour, wheat bran, brown rice), nuts, and the skins of many fruits and vegetables like potatoes and pears.

The Rise of Resistant Starch

Beyond the traditional soluble and insoluble categories, resistant starch is another type of carbohydrate with significant digestive health benefits. It is a type of starch that resists digestion in the small intestine and functions much like fermentable fiber in the large intestine.

  • Feeding Gut Bacteria: Like soluble fiber, resistant starch ferments in the colon, providing fuel for beneficial bacteria.
  • Producing Butyrate: The fermentation of resistant starch is particularly known for producing butyrate, a critical short-chain fatty acid that is the preferred fuel source for the cells lining the colon. Butyrate supports the integrity of the gut wall and may protect against serious digestive diseases.

Foods containing resistant starch include underripe bananas, cooked and cooled potatoes or rice, and legumes.

The Importance of a Diverse Fiber Intake

While each type of fiber offers specific benefits, a truly healthy digestive system thrives on a diverse range of plant-based foods that provide a mix of different fiber types. Overemphasis on a single type of fiber or the use of supplements over whole foods can lead to an unbalanced diet. The gut microbiome is a complex ecosystem, and a variety of fermentable carbohydrates helps to support a more diverse and resilient microbial community.

Practical Steps to Boost Your Fiber Intake

Increasing fiber intake should be a gradual process to avoid gas, bloating, and cramping. Accompanying increased fiber consumption with plenty of fluids is also essential, as fiber works best when it can absorb water.

Start with small changes:

  • Swap refined grains for whole grains. Choose brown rice over white rice, whole-wheat bread over white bread, and whole-wheat pasta instead of regular.
  • Add legumes to your meals. Incorporate beans, lentils, and chickpeas into soups, salads, and stews.
  • Embrace fruits and vegetables. Eat whole fruits instead of juice, and keep the skins on when possible. Snack on raw veggies or a handful of nuts.
  • Try resistant starch hacks. Cook and cool starchy foods like potatoes or pasta before eating them. Add uncooked oatmeal or wheat bran to baked goods.
  • Mind your fluids. Drink plenty of water throughout the day to help the fiber move smoothly through your digestive system.

The Synergy of Fiber and the Gut Microbiome

The gut microbiome plays a pivotal role in overall health, and dietary fiber is one of its most important modulators. A fiber-rich diet promotes a higher diversity of gut microbes, which is associated with better health outcomes. When gut bacteria ferment fiber, they produce beneficial SCFAs like butyrate, which protect the gut lining and regulate immune function. Conversely, a low-fiber diet can lead to a less diverse microbiome and increased risk of inflammatory diseases.

Comparison Table: Types of Digestive Carbohydrates

Feature Soluble Fiber Insoluble Fiber Resistant Starch
Dissolves in Water? Yes, forms a gel. No, remains mostly intact. No, but is fermentable.
Function in Digestion Slows digestion, controls blood sugar, and lowers cholesterol. Adds bulk to stool, speeds up transit time, and prevents constipation. Feeds beneficial gut bacteria and produces beneficial SCFAs.
Best Food Sources Oats, barley, nuts, seeds, legumes, apples, carrots. Whole grains, wheat bran, nuts, legumes, and vegetable skins. Underripe bananas, legumes, cooled potatoes, and cooled rice.
Primary Benefit Manages blood sugar and cholesterol levels, feeds gut bacteria. Promotes regularity and prevents constipation and diverticular disease. Supports the gut lining and a diverse microbiome.
